Dentists talk about overhead, EBITDA, and take-home pay all the time—but most aren’t actually calculating them the same way. In this episode of The Dental CEO Podcast, Scott Leune breaks down what these numbers really mean, how to calculate them correctly, and the benchmarks healthy practices should aim for. He explains the difference between true overhead and discretionary spending, how EBITDA should be calculated after doctor compensation, and why many dentists with 60–65% overhead are unknowingly losing hundreds of thousands in potential income each year.
